2014年04月06日
1次関数と回転座標
回転座標をエクセルで計算させるには
行列
x cos(θ) -sin(θ)
=
y sin(θ) cos(θ)
と計算します。
セルに入力する計算式は下の図のようになります。
x値、y値、θ値を自由に変えられるようにエクセルで作るとこのようになります。
角度(θ)はラジアンに変換させます。 RADIANS( )
移動後の x’の計算式は = (x*cos(θ)) + (y*(-1)*sin(θ))
同じく y’の計算式は = (x*sin(θ)) + (y*cos(θ))
1つのセルの中に全ての計算式を入れることもできますが、θ値を何度も使うときは別にしておいた方が便利です。
(一度に複数の点(座標)をθだけ回転させる場合など)
時計回り(右回り)に回転させるときは計算式が変わります。
行列
x cos(θ) sin(θ)
=
y -sin(θ) cos(θ)
と計算します。
セルに入力する計算式は下の図のようになります。
セルに入力する計算式はこのようになります。
角度(θ)はラジアンに変換させます。 RADIANS( )
移動後の x’の計算式は = (x*cos(θ)) + (y*sin(θ))
同じく y’の計算式は = (x*(-1)*sin(θ)) + (y*cos(θ))
この記事へのコメント
コメントを書く
この記事へのトラックバックURL
https://fanblogs.jp/tb/2335756
※ブログオーナーが承認したトラックバックのみ表示されます。
この記事へのトラックバック